Kate Winslet Wins Libel Case

Kate Winselt at the premier of 'Away We Go'

Oscar winning actress Kate Winslet has won a $40,000 libel suit against British tabloid The Daily Mail for saying she lied about her exercise regime.

“I strongly believe that women should be encouraged to accept themselves as they are, so to suggest that I was lying was an unacceptable accusation of hypocrisy,” the 33-year-old mother of two said in a statement.

In the British High Court on Tuesday (November 3), The Daily Mail accepted that the allegations in their January 30 article, “Should Kate Winslet win an Oscar for the World’s most irritating actress?”, were false.

“I am delighted that the Mail have apologized for making false allegations about me,” Winslet said in the statement. “I was particularly upset to be accused of lying about my exercise regime, and felt that I had a responsibility to request an apology in order to demonstrate my commitment to the views that I have always expressed about body issues, including diet and exercise.”

The Daily Mail also agreed to publish an apology, pay damages to Winslet as well as her legal fees.
